Output 08d87b51fadb8b5edcddb3c20d5e16fb086e5ca42c9a653b160bd923edb800ad:0

value
29744610
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a0d38cb96824b0d85ffcbb5cd111485633432d4 OP_EQUAL
address
344mLCfv6s8WGsRLHdWMtUgQjsmpCcbvvt
transaction
08d87b51fadb8b5edcddb3c20d5e16fb086e5ca42c9a653b160bd923edb800ad
confirmations
335484
spent
true